House of Reps postpones resumption

TambuwalMembers of The House of Representatives were on Tuesday informed of the postponement of their resumption from recess earlier scheduled for Wednesday, December 3.

A statement signed by Clerk of the House, M.A. Sani-Omolori, said the lawmakers will now resume on Tuesday, December 16 at 10am.

“The Leadership of the House of Representatives took note of the adjustment in the calendar of the political parties and took the decision for the postponement to allow Members of the House participate in the forthcoming Primaries of their political parties,” the statement said.

It will be recalled that policemen and Department of State Security (DSS) operatives invaded the National Assembly on Thursday, November 20 to prevent Speaker of the House of Representatives, Aminu Tambuwal, and other opposition members from entering the building for a key security vote.

Tambuwal defected from the ruling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) to opposition All Peoples Congress (APC) in October.

The PDP and Inspector General of Police, Suleiman Abba, have tried to remove Tambuwal from the speaker’s chair and stripped him of his security aides.
